Best Internet Provider In Harbor, OR

Spectrum dominates the Harbor, Oregon, internet scene with a steady cable connection. It coats an impressive 99% of the community with broadband access, offering residents a maximum download speed of up to 1 Gbps. Affordable rates starting at $49.99 per month make Spectrum an excellent choice for high-speed, value-priced internet.

T-Mobile 5G Home Internet and Ziply Fiber also stake their claim for Harbor's internet users. T-Mobile blankets 82% of the area with 5G coverage, offering download speeds between 33 and 245 Mbps. Monthly plans begin at $50, a competitive price for its broad reach. Meanwhile, Ziply Fiber hits the top speed among the three, racing up to 5 Gbps with its fiber and DSL connections. Ensuring its services are universally available, it boasts a 100% coverage rate in Harbor, with rates that deliver impressive affordability, starting at $10 per month.

Additionally, Viasat Internet satisfies the needs of those living in the more challenging-to-reach areas of Harbor. Its satellite connection, offering a maximum download speed of 35 Mbps, provides comprehensive coverage, enhancing internet availability across the entire community.
